GC&SU tennis sweeps Fort Valley State

The Georgia College & State University Bobcats made quick work of the Wildcats of Fort Valley State University Tuesday afternoon at the Centennial Center Tennis Facility.

The women blanked FVSU 9-0, while the men snapped a three-game losing streak with the 7-1 victory. The women improve to 6-0 on the season, and the men improve to 4-7.

In women’s play, the Bobcats began the day by winning all three doubles matches. GC&SU’s tandem of Caroline Lefevre and Anna Shchupak picked up an 8-1 victory over FVSU’s Tasha Evans and Shemaka Josey to lead the Bobcats in doubles play.

Annika Persson and Kremena Vassileva defeated Janine Atkins and Latitia Adams with the 8-0 victory.

In singles action, GC&SU’s Mia Paavilainen defeated Evans in straight sets 6-0; 6-0, while Lefevre defeated Josey with the 6-0; 6-0 victory.
Shchupak won 6-0; 6-0 over Atkins, while Vassileva also won in straight sets for the Bobcats with a 6-0; 6-0 victory over Adams. Kelly Miller completed the sweep with a 6-0; 6-1 win over Courtney Smith.
GC&SU also picked up wins doubles and singles by default as the Wildcats did not have enough players.

In the men’s match, GC&SU quickly took the advantage by winning two of the three doubles matches. FVSU’s Tshaka and Kweka Symonette paired up for an 8-5 win over GC&SU’s James Gorin and Kris Popovic before the tandem of Thomas Karlsson and Per Schartum-Hansen won 8-0 over Jonathan Chaffin and Marshal Northington for the Bobcats first point. Brandon Lee and Mikael Pettersson picked up the second point doubles with an 8-5 win over Pat Lee and Robert Isaacs.

The Bobcats turned on the heat in singles play sweeping 5 of the 6 matches before rain canceled the final match. GC&SU’s James Gorin held on for the 6-3; 7-6 victory over Isaacs, while Schartum-Hansen defeated Kweka Symonette 6-2; 6-2. Popovic defeated Tshaka Symonette 6-4; 6-2 singles, while Pettersson defeated Lee in straight sets 6-1; 6-1. Brandon Lee won 6-1; 6-0 against Northington

The match between Thomas Hemmestad and Derrick Pace did not finish due to rain.
